Impeccable storytelling. As a true crime lover I've watched/listened to almost every documentary or podcast when it comes to serial killers, including all of the MONSTERS series on Netflix.
Peacock really hit it out of the park with their depiction of John Wayne Gacy. JWG, in my opinion, holds a candle to the likes of Dahmer or Gein due to the fact that his story will definitely make you queasy. I mean they all do, but when you can take on writing such a story with enough thought and research, and give credit to the victims and their families, it can be easier to stomach.
Bravo to Peacock for the outstanding writing, casting, and direction. The mood is dark and ominous, perfectly paced, and worth the watch.
